Transaction 08e62d93413cd547ade59cfb3b5fcb057242c6878ee0cd70781e12856bd59a66

1 Input
2 Outputs
  • 08e62d93413cd547ade59cfb3b5fcb057242c6878ee0cd70781e12856bd59a66:0
  • value  21490462
    address  1HVXwsdSrCrcZaNan5whczJUYBFYRPGWVs
  • 08e62d93413cd547ade59cfb3b5fcb057242c6878ee0cd70781e12856bd59a66:1
  • value  1578076
    address  14DoB316o5LvW4sChAhPdq5iTtMvnjvZ8q